Menthadienyl acetate is a substance that adds flavor to cosmetics. It is a clear or slightly yellow liquid that has a spearmint-like scent.
What is the purpose of Isocarvyl Acetate in personal care products?
It is used for its flavoring characteristics.
Isocarvyl Acetate ** provides a taste and smell.**
Names and identifiers that we found for this substance include: Isocarvyl Acetate, Menthadienyl acetate, 2-Methylene-5-(1-methylethenyl)cyclohexyl acetate, "p-Mentha-1(7),8-dien-2-ol, acetate", 2-Methylidene-5-(prop-1-en-2-yl)cyclohexyl acetate, and "Cyclohexanol, 2-methylene-5-(1-methylethenyl)-, 1-acetate".

Flavoring ingredients in cosmetic products give them a specific taste and smell. Like how spices and seasonings give food a distinct flavor and aroma, flavorings add unique characteristics to cosmetic products. Natural flavorings are typically derived from plants, fruits, and herbs, while artificial flavorings are created using chemical compounds.
Flavoring ingredients can be added to lip balms, toothpaste, mouthwash, and other cosmetic products that come into contact with the mouth. These flavorings are usually created from natural or artificial ingredients and are carefully measured to ensure the product tastes and smells right.
